Director of Service & Parts (Mining)
All, Manufacturing
Englewood, CO
Location: Englewood, CO | Schedule: Full-time, office-based with extensive field and mine-site travel
Overview
A large-scale industrial equipment and service provider serving the mining and bulk material handling sectors is seeking an experienced Service & Aftermarket leader to grow its Service & Parts operation. This role will drive an After Sales growth strategy, expand spare parts revenue, and build long-term customer relationships across the mining industry, while overseeing Service Department operations in close coordination with engineering, mine maintenance personnel, vendors, and executive leadership.
